Job Description :
Role#1
DirectClient: Railroad Commission of Texas (RRC)
Solicitation#45511990-1
Title: Data Architect/Data Analyst
Location: 1701 N. Congress Ave 8th and 10th floors, Austin, Texas
Duration: Until 8/31/2019 with possible extension
Last date for submission: April 1, 2019 (2.00 PM-CST)

Job Description:
All work products resulting from the project shall be considered “works made for hire” and are the property of the RRC. RRC may include pre-selection requirements that potential Vendors (and their Workers) submit to and satisfy criminal background checks as authorized by the Texas law. RRC will pay no fees for interviews or discussions, which occur during the process of selecting a Worker(s

Performs advanced (senior-level) data analysis and architecture work including data modeling; implementing, designing and managing database systems, data warehouses, and ETL Data Interfaces.
Performs discovery and refactoring of database ETL processes from mainframe IMS databases to Oracle RDMS.
Determines database requirements by analyzing business operations, applications, and programming; reviewing business objectives; and evaluating current systems.
Obtains data model requirements, develops and implements data models for new projects, and maintains existing data models and data architectures.
Develops data structures for data warehouses and data mart projects and initiatives; and supports data analytics and business intelligence systems
Implements corresponding database changes to support new and existing (or modified) applications, and ensures new designs conform to data standards and guidelines; are consistent, properly normalized, and perform as required; and are secure from unauthorized access or update.
Develops or advises guidelines on creating data models and various standards relating to governed data.
Reviews changes to technical and business metadata, realizing their impacts on enterprise applications, and ensures the impacts are communicated to appropriate parties.
Reviews measures to chart progress related to the completeness and quality of metadata for enterprise information; to support reduction of data redundancy and fragmentation and elimination of unnecessary movement of data; and to improve data quality.
Consults, advises and selects data management tools and develops standards, usage guidelines and procedures for those tools.
Consults, advises and documents proper data governance and data compliance process and procedures.
Identifies appropriate data sourcing and extraction processes. Identifies and nominates sources as systems of record for data usage in various applications.
Performs root cause analyses (RDA) related to information issues and non-conformance to published data standards based on review of technical metadata of various source systems.
Creates graphics and other flow diagrams (including ERD) to show complex database design and database modeling more simply.
May plan, assign, and/or supervise the work of others and capable of working with minimal supervision
Performs related work as assigned.

WORKER S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S
Minimum Requirements:
Years Skills/Experience
4 Experienced 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) programmer using tools like Informatica PowerCenter or other similar ETL or iPaaS tool.
4 Experience with SQL and PL/SQL procedure writing.
4 Experience with database design, database refactoring and database tuning
4 Experience in hierarchical database and relational database design theory such as normalization
4 Experience with RDMS including Oracle
2 Experience using advanced SQL Database modeling tools such as Toad Data Modeling.
2 Experienced in the documentation of complex database concepts, data objects, data governance, data ETL processes, and database schemas including the creation of ERD diagrams and UML parent/child data relationship diagrams.
2 Experience with taking convoluted and unfactored database structures and unmodeled data and having an end-to-end vision for both logical, physical and conceptual database construction and architecture.

Preferences:
Years Skills/Experience
2 Specific experience in working on IBM z/OS (v02.02), with IMS (v14.1) Databases, and with VSAM file structures as an ETL source and target
2 Specific experience with PowerExchange for IMS including creating from scratch ETL mapping from IMS to a RDBMS
Data Warehouse experience is valuable
